Volunteers recently provided physical, spiritual and emotional support to patients in the People Living with HIV Ward, Port Moresby General Hospital.
Each patient was very appreciative to be given a delicious fresh fruit platter which was enjoyed by each one.
Many patients have no family or friends to support them through this painful journey.
For some patients we are “family”. One they can confide, request prayer, and simply just “be there” for them.
Through visiting our friends, it serves as a reminder we are fulfilling our Mission Statement: Inspired by the Example of Jesus, Operation Food for Life seeks to provide physical, emotional and spiritual support, bringing dignity and hope to the forgotten and the disadvantaged.
